Default The OHL hit on Ben Fanelli

http://news.therecord.com/Sports/article/624864

Quote:
Fanelli was airlifted to Hamilton General on Friday night with skull and facial fractures he suffered when he was checked into the end boards during a game against the Erie Otters at the Aud.
Googling "Ben Fanelli" will allow you to watch the devastating body check on YouTube. My questions:

1) Was it clean? I feel it was. Fanelli turns at the last minute in order to pass in the other direction, but it seemed like a clean check. No charging, Michael Liambas didn't leave his feet, no stick involved...

2) Should Michael Liambas have been suspended (for the rest of the season or not)?

3) Is this a freak accident, or does hockey need to overhaul its rules on body contact?
